CSS引用選擇器是一種非常方便的技術,可以讓我們在CSS中使用其他選擇器的定義,以便更好地實現樣式。一個選擇器的定義可以在不同的地方使用,這樣可以避免重復定義樣式,提高工作效率。
p { font-size: 16px; color: #333; } /* 引用p選擇器 */ h1 { @extend p; font-size: 24px; }
上面的代碼演示了如何使用@extend
關鍵字引用p
選擇器的定義。這樣,在h1
標簽內,font-size
和color
屬性將被繼承,并且可以通過h1
標簽重新定義和覆蓋這些樣式。
/* 自定義選擇器 */ .btn { display: inline; padding: 10px 20px; background-color: #333; color: #fff; border-radius: 5px; } /* 引用.btn選擇器 */ a.button { @extend .btn; text-decoration: none; }
上面的代碼演示了如何自定義選擇器,并在另一個選擇器中引用它。這樣可以盡可能減少代碼重復,并確保更一致的樣式。
總之,CSS引用選擇器是一種非常強大的技術,可以在樣式文件中更好地組織樣式,減少代碼重復,并提高開發效率。
上一篇css彈性布局邊距
下一篇jquery進行加減乘除